Transaction c1ef2d589ecf48c55bb9e6dd94238509367e61c980e2d4d781987be128cfdba6
1 Input
1 Outputs
- c1ef2d589ecf48c55bb9e6dd94238509367e61c980e2d4d781987be128cfdba6:0
value 19120940
address 3K2C36yqDRhuMxy4PrYMQ2b4tmahEAXd54